Market Analysis highlights that cocoa butter substitutes (CBS) have become essential ingredients in compound chocolates, coatings, fillings, and molded confectionery items.

Cocoa butter substitutes are typically derived from specific vegetable fats that mimic the functional attributes of cocoa butter, particularly when combined with sugar, cocoa powder, or milk solids. Their unique composition enables them to harden quickly, resist melting under warmer conditions, and offer a desirable snap—making them ideal for large-scale confectionery production. As the industry continues to diversify its offerings, CBS provide manufacturers with increased flexibility in product design and formulation.

One of the major factors driving the rising demand for cocoa butter substitutes is the focus on production efficiency. Traditional cocoa butter requires precise tempering, which can be complex and time-consuming. In contrast, many CBS formulations eliminate the need for tempering, allowing confectionery producers to streamline their manufacturing processes and reduce operational complexity. This enhances productivity and enables faster production cycles, especially for high-volume products.

Furthermore, cocoa butter substitutes offer improved heat resistance compared to conventional cocoa butter. This characteristic is crucial for confectionery manufacturers operating in warm or tropical regions where product stability can be a challenge. By using CBS, brands can maintain consistent product quality during transportation and retail display, reducing the risk of bloom formation or shape distortion. In addition to performance benefits, CBS are widely utilized due to their ability to maintain flavor integrity in confectionery applications. Although they do not replicate the exact melt profile of cocoa butter, modern advancements in lipid structuring technologies have significantly improved their sensory characteristics. Food producers can tailor blends to achieve smoother textures, stable finishes, and enhanced mouthfeel—attributes that consumers expect in chocolate-based treats.

The rise in compound chocolate usage further contributes to the increasing adoption of cocoa butter substitutes. Compound chocolates are popular in bakery coatings, dough inclusions, ice cream layers, and confectionery shells. They offer a cost-effective alternative to true chocolate while delivering similar sensory qualities. CBS play a central role in ensuring these products retain the right texture, shine, and crunch without requiring advanced tempering processes.

Another important element driving the demand for CBC in confectionery is the rapid expansion of chocolate-coated snacks. Products such as wafers, cereal bars, nuts, cookies, and fruit-based treats often rely on CBS for coatings because they harden quickly and remain stable at ambient temperatures. This allows manufacturers to optimize line speed and minimize defects, contributing to smoother production cycles across the confectionery Industry.

The increasing popularity of plant-based confectionery is also influencing the use of cocoa butter substitutes. As vegan and dairy-free chocolate varieties become more mainstream, manufacturers require fat systems that deliver stability without relying on milk-derived lipids. Many CBS formulations cater to plant-based product developers by offering non-dairy, allergen-friendly, and versatile fat profiles that support the development of new confectionery innovations.
